What the two formats actually are

Both are containers: boxes that hold compressed video and audio streams. What differs is the compression inside and who backs the format.

MP4 (H.264)

MP4 carrying H.264 video is the closest thing digital video has to a universal standard. Every phone, TV, browser, editing app, and messaging service made in the last decade plays it. Hardware decoding for H.264 is built into essentially every device, which means smooth playback and gentle battery use.

WebM

WebM is an open, royalty-free format championed by Google, typically carrying VP8 or VP9 video. It was designed for the web, and browsers support it well. Outside browsers, support is patchier: some phones, TVs, and desktop players, and several messaging and social apps, either refuse WebM files or handle them inconsistently.

Compatibility: the deciding factor

For most people this table settles it. Sending the video to another person or uploading to social apps? MP4, no hesitation: iMessage, WhatsApp, TikTok, Instagram, and older devices all treat MP4 as native. Embedding on your own website for browsers? WebM is a first-class citizen and often produces smaller files at similar quality. YouTube happily accepts both and re-encodes everything anyway.

One niche worth knowing: browser-based screen recorders commonly produce WebM natively, because it is the format browsers speak most fluently. If a recording arrives as WebM and needs to go somewhere WebM-hostile, opening it in an editor and exporting MP4 is the clean conversion, and you can trim it in the same pass.

Quality and file size

At typical settings the visual difference between a good H.264 MP4 and a good WebM export is small; both look clean for screen recordings, phone footage, and slideshows. WebM’s newer codecs can squeeze somewhat smaller files at comparable quality, which is why the web likes it. But a smaller file that a recipient’s phone cannot open is worth exactly nothing, which keeps MP4 the default for sharing.

Other formats you will run into

A quick map of the neighbors, since export menus and downloads are full of them. MOV is Apple’s container; modern MOV files usually carry the same H.264 video as MP4, which is why most tools open them interchangeably. MKV is a flexible open container beloved for archiving because it can hold almost any codec, but device and app support is spottier than MP4. Animated GIF is not really video at all: enormous files, no audio, limited colors; a short muted MP4 or WebM beats a GIF on every measure except being embeddable in places that only accept GIFs.

The pattern to internalize: the container (MP4, WebM, MOV, MKV) is the box, and the codec inside (H.264, VP9, and newer ones like AV1) is what actually determines quality, size, and whether a device can play it. When a file “will not open somewhere”, it is nearly always the codec, not the container. The simple rule

  • Default to MP4. Sharing with people, posting to social platforms, uploading to YouTube, archiving: MP4 (H.264) is the safe universal answer.
  • Choose WebM when the web is the destination and you control the player: embedding on your own site, or workflows that specifically want an open, royalty-free format.
  • When unsure, MP4. The cost of the wrong WebM choice is a video someone cannot open; the cost of the wrong MP4 choice is a slightly larger file.

Which format is smaller?

Usually WebM at comparable quality, though the gap depends on content and settings. For typical short videos the difference rarely changes what you can do with the file.
